BIM Fest 2008: The Klinik, The Names, Vomito Negro, The Cassandra Complex, Signal Aout’42, No More, Plastic Noise Experience, Catholic Boys in Heavy Leather, The Arch, Psy’Aviah
December is not only the time, when a big guy with a white beard on a reindeer skid, delivers presents, it usually is also the month, where many fans of dark music travel to Belgium as it’s time again for the Belgium Independent Music Festival, short BIM Fest. This year, the festival went into its 7th round and will came up with lots of highlights, leading the way with a performance of the absolute legendary formation THE KLINIK, who returned from the dead and presented a mixture of classics and brand-new material. But the fest did not stop there already. The organizers invited no one less than VOMITO NEGRO for the 7th issue of the festival, who’re working on a new album right now and presented new material. http://www.bimfest.be

electriXmas Festival: Welle:Erdball, Agonoize, Interlace, Autodafeh, Biomekkanik
Being the follower of Virtual X-mas, electriXmas is taking place every year in December since 2002 and developed to one of Sweden’s most famous synth festivals. The line-up this year was again very mixed between “old” heroes of synth music and new talents. Acts from abroad belonged to the line-up as well as local bands. After the festival was taking place for several years in Lund, it moved to Malmö in 2007 and is now taking place at Inkonst, which is set in an old chocolate factory and is part of Kulturhuset Mazetti where it invites everything from experimental minority activities to well known events in theatre, music, dance, art and clubs.
